Membership is still a challenge 978 members/fellows/affiliates etc 2006 490 members/fellows/affiliates etc 2013 Membership Year%Decline%YoY Jul-14490-50-8.92 Jul-13538-45-8.50 Jul-12588-40-6.37 Jul-11628-36-8.85 Jul-10689-303.30 Jul-09667-32-16.42 Jul-08798-18-6.88 Jul-07857-12-12.37 Jul-06978 New Membership Office – Tony Ginda

What are we thinking 20015/16 Membership decline – unsustainable Survey about to be undertaken Current IOH Model unsustainable – Clear Re-positioning as voice of tourism and hospitality managers/supervisors for Leadership and Management Chartered Institute for Tourism and Hospitality (CITH) – Is that a more relevant re-positioning? Head Office to Centrist / Autocratic - decentralise Lack of regular consultation – Education/Membership More regular pro-active discussion CEO/Chairs More Vision from HQ for IOH Scotland which outside London is the second largest Hospitality & Tourism hub in UK New local paid role in Scotland - Employee in Italy (Editor Hospitality Magazine) – Sets the Precedent Create Northern Powerhouse – decentralise an official/s from London base (16) to create sales / PR roles
